Laura Hare Preserve at Blossom Hollow is a nature reserve in Indiana, at a modelled 241 m. Weed Patch Hill stands 322 m to the south, 13 miles off. The nearest named place is Betley Woods at Glacier's End, a nature reserve 0.9 miles away. Historic National Road - Indiana passes 27 miles off.
- Operated by
- Central Indiana Land Trust

Months averaging 50–80 °F: Apr–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 27 | 30 | 40 | 51 | 62 | 71 | 74 | 72 | 66 | 54 | 42 | 32 |
| Precip in | 3.0 | 2.5 | 3.6 | 4.9 | 5.3 | 5.1 | 4.2 | 3.3 | 3.2 | 3.3 | 3.5 | 3.4 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Franklin Wwtp, 11 mi away.
